Market Leaders Overview
In the world of digital currencies, a few key players have established themselves as forefront challengers, transforming the landscape of digital assets. BTC, the first and most recognized cryptocurrency, continues to be the top choice for investors seeking a store of value. It has maintained its preeminence due to its distributed nature, robust security measures, and a robust network impetus. With a finite quantity capped at 21 million tokens, Bitcoin is commonly referred to as digital gold, attracting those looking for long-term value preservation.
ETH, another major player, has revolutionized the space with its capabilities for smart contracts. This framework allows developers to build decentralized applications and has nurtured the growth of the DeFi sector. As the second-largest cryptocurrency by market cap, Ethereum’s adaptability and ongoing upgrades, such as the upgrade to Ethereum 2.0, underscore its promise for scalability and sustainability. Its expanding ecosystem continues to draw substantial attention from both speculators and innovators alike.
Ripple’s XRP has distinguished by concentrating on facilitating cross-border payments and money transfers. By utilizing distributed ledger technology, Ripple strives to provide financial institutions and financial organizations with a more effective alternative to traditional payment systems. Despite facing regulatory challenges, XRP’s alliances with key financial entities underline its capability to integrate into existing financial frameworks. The achievements of these market leaders demonstrates the varied functionalities and increasing acceptance of cryptocurrencies in multiple sectors.
Technology and Advancement
The evolution of distributed ledger tech has been a crucial aspect of the cryptocurrency landscape. Advancements such as smart contracts and decentralized finance have transformed how we think about financial deals and contracts. Smart contracts, which automatically execute tasks based on predefined criteria, have given rise to countless applications across various industries. This technological advancement makes deals more effective and reliable, reducing the need for middlemen and enhancing safety.
In addition to automated contracts, expansion solutions have emerged to tackle the limitations of current blockchain systems. Initiatives like Ethereum 2.0 and layer 2s like LN aim to increase deal throughput while decreasing fees. As adoption grows, these technologies are essential for maintaining a smooth user experience, especially during peak demand periods. The ability to handle deals at high volume will influence the long-term viability of cryptocurrencies as common financial tools.
Furthermore, new consensus mechanisms are being developed to improve security and eco-friendliness in blockchain networks. PoS and Delegated Proof of Stake, for example, are gaining traction as green substitutes to classic PoW protocols. These innovative methods not only tackle the ecological effects of crypto mining but also enhance the resilience and decentralization of networks, paving the way for broader adoption in an increasingly eco-conscious world.
